Darknuts (タートナック, Tātonakku) are enemies from The Legend of Zelda series.

In Super Smash Bros. Brawl[]

Darknut Trophy

Darknut appears as a trophy.

Trophy Description[]

A knight enemy clad in heavy armor that defends with a shield and attacks with sword techniques and kicks. Darknuts lose their armor as they take hits, but they grow faster in the process. Their sword skills are quite accomplished. The most fundamental way of dealing with Darknuts is having good command of spin attacks and back slices.

In Super Smash Bros. 3DS/Wii U[]

Darknut Smash Run

Darknut appears as an enemy in Smash Run, with its design from The Legend of Zelda: Twilight Princess.

Like Stalfos, their shields will block incoming attacks so they must be hit from the back to deal damage. However, their attacks are different compared to Stalfos; while Stalfos move backwards and then lunge towards the player, a Darknut's heavy armor prevents it from doing so. Instead, they use powerful sword attacks in various ways and can react quickly if a player rolls past their frontal attack. Once enough damage is dealt to the armor, it will break. This will make the Darknut faster and use a different set of attacks, but they can now be killed and be affected by powerful attacks.

Trophy Description[]

These heavily armored, bulky enemies often seen in the Legend of Zelda series are slow but powerful and can use their swords to block attacks and projectiles. When you're faced with one, you'll need to slowly cut away its armor. Once it's gone, the Darknut will become more agile, but it'll also be more vulnerable!
